Python Language例外


前書き

実行中に検出されたエラーは例外と呼ばれ、無条件に致命的ではありません。ほとんどの例外はプログラムによって処理されません。選択した例外を処理するプログラムを記述することができます。 Pythonには、例外や例外ロジックを扱う特定の機能があります。さらに、例外には豊富な型階層があり、すべてBaseException型を継承しています。

構文

  • 例外を提起する
  • raise#すでに発生している例外を再発生させる
  • 原因#Pythonから引き上げる3 - 例外の原因を設定する
  • 例外をNoneから出す#Python 3 - すべての例外コンテキストを抑止する
  • 試してください:
  • [ 識別子として] [例外タイプ]を除きます。
  • else:
  • 最後に:

例外 関連する例